Heartwell Services, LLC is a nonprofit organization dedicated to empowering ad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ities through individualized support, life skills coaching, community engagement, and supported living services. The organization focuses on promoting independence, continuity of care, and self-empowerment, providing comprehensive health care coordination and behavior management strategies to enhance quality of life.
